Prestigious Performances
For experienced groups with a high standard of sacred or classical repertoire.
Église St Clotilde
This gothic church has excellent acoustics, as well as a famous organ originally constructed by the renowned French organ maker Cavaillé-Coll, and played by composer César Franck.
Notre Dame Cathedral
High quality choirs with a sacred repertoire can apply to perform a short weekday recital or participate in mass on Saturday evenings or Sunday mornings, at this world-renowned cathedral.
Église Madeleine
Sacred choirs and classical orchestras can perform as part of the regular weekday concert series which attracts great audiences.
Chartres Cathedral
Just 90 minutes from Paris, this prestigious cathedral has an excellent reputation as a concert venue for orchestras and choirs.
Église St Germaine-des-Prés
Good quality sacred choirs can perform at mass or at an individual concert performance.
Église St Sulpice
Sunday afternoon concerts are possible or groups can undertake a full evening concert. This church also boasts a grand organ manufactured by Cavaillé-Coll.
Indoor Performances
A selection of indoor venues to suit a range of abilities and repertoires.
Hôpital Robert Debré
Mid-week concerts at this centrally-located children’s hospital are great for bands and choirs and a rewarding experience for groups.
Val d’Europe Music Kiosk
Located close to Disneyland® Paris, this indoor shopping centre is an ideal visit for groups after they have been to Disneyland® Paris.
The German Church
NST have used this venue for a number of years with great success. Well known for its excellent acoustics, the German Church is used by many orchestras and choirs to make professional recordings.
Notre Dame Pentecostal Church, La Défense
This modern church located in Paris’ business district offers a variety of groups the opportunity to perform.
Rothschild Foundation (Maison de Retraite et de Gériatrie)
Secular groups can perform in this large, residential centre to a sizeable, appreciative audience
Outdoor Venues
A selection of open air and covered venues to suit a range of abilities and repertoires.
Jardin du Luxembourg
Located in the gardens of the Palais du Luxembourg, this venue has first-class acoustics and regularly attracts good audiences.
Parc Montsouris
Concerts are held on the covered park bandstand, which overlooks the lake in this popular, residential park.
Champs de Mars
Situated in a busy area close to the Eiffel Tower, these city gardens are perfect for groups with a lively repertoire.
Square Jean XXIII
Groups can perform on the bandstand podium located in a green leafy space, directly behind Notre Dame Cathedral.
Georges Brassens Bandstand
A covered, modern bandstand which hosts performances for a largely local audience.

Disneyland® Paris -Magic Music Days
The Disney Magic Music Days programme offers performance opportunities to amateur groups, with the aim of giving participants a glimpse into Disney’s world of entertainment by offering them a unique, once in a lifetime experience! Four main group types are eligible to apply: Instrumental, Choral, Dance & Marching Bands. A co-ordination team is assigned to each group to guide them through organising their visit and preparing for their ‘Disney Magic Music Days’ show, as well as taking care of them on their arrival and for the performance itself. A Disney technical team are also on hand to add those finishing touches and make sure everything runs smoothly for a magical experience they will never forget! Disneyland® Paris - Vocal Workshop
A challenging new workshop designed to initiate and inspire young singers. “Intermediate Vocalist” is aimed at the 11 to 16 years age group. The first steps on an exciting journey from basic musical literacy and the progressive development of vocal technique to the delights of live performance.
The “Intermediate Vocalist” sessions will last approx. 90 minutes. Preliminary warm up exercises will embrace posture, breath control,
diction and voice production. Stylistic analysis and interpretation of one and two part melodic material drawn from Disney classics will follow. Workshops are also available for Dance and Musical Theatre groups. Please call for further details.
